Pfx to crt and key windows

Как преобразовать PFX в формат CRT и KEY в Windows

В системе Windows PFX-файл (Personal Exchange Format) является форматом файлового контейнера для хранения и защиты цифровых сертификатов и соответствующих им ключей. CRT-файл (Certificate) представляет собой открытый сертификат без личной информации, а KEY-файл содержит партию закрытых ключей, которые используются вместе с сертификатом для обеспечения безопасности и проверки подлинности при обмене данными.

В случае необходимости преобразования PFX-файла в CRT и KEY в системе Windows есть несколько способов выполнить эту операцию. Это может быть полезно, например, когда вы хотите использовать сертификат в другой системе, которая не поддерживает PFX-формат или требует отдельных CRT- и KEY-файлов.

Один из подходов к преобразованию PFX в CRT и KEY в системе Windows — использование утилиты OpenSSL. Это свободно распространяемая программная платформа, которая поддерживает широкий спектр криптографических функций. Чтобы выполнить преобразование, вам понадобится установить OpenSSL на свой компьютер и использовать следующую команду из командной строки:

openssl pkcs12 -in filename.pfx -clcerts -nokeys -out filename.crt

Здесь «filename.pfx» — это имя вашего PFX-файла, который вы хотите преобразовать в CRT. После выполнения этой команды OpenSSL считывает PFX-файл, извлекает открытый сертификат без личной информации и сохраняет его в новом CRT-файле.

Чтобы получить KEY-файл, вы можете использовать эту команду вместо предыдущей:

openssl pkcs12 -in filename.pfx -nocerts -out filename.key

Теперь у вас есть отдельные CRT- и KEY-файлы, которые вы можете использовать в другой системе или приложении по своему усмотрению. Помните, что KEY-файл является конфиденциальной информацией и должен храниться в безопасном месте для предотвращения несанкционированного доступа к вашим ключам и сертификатам.

Преобразование PFX в CRT и KEY в системе Windows может быть полезным при различных сценариях использования, особенно если вам требуется комбинировать или передавать сертификаты и ключи между разными системами и приложениями.

Что такое PFX и как его конвертировать в форматы CRT и KEY в Windows?

Существует несколько способов конвертирования PFX в форматы CRT и KEY в Windows. Вот несколько простых шагов, которые помогут вам выполнить это действие:

Использование командной строки и утилиты OpenSSL

1. Во-первых, убедитесь, что у вас установлена утилита OpenSSL. Если она отсутствует, загрузите и установите ее с официального сайта.

Читайте также:  Windows server 2019 optimization

2. Откройте командную строку и перейдите в папку, где находится ваш PFX-файл.

3. Используйте следующую команду для извлечения закрытого ключа и сертификата CRT из PFX:

openssl pkcs12 -in ваш_файл.pfx -nocerts -out ключ.key

4. Введите пароль от PFX-файла, когда система запросит его.

5. Затем введите следующую команду, чтобы извлечь сертификат CRT:

openssl pkcs12 -in ваш_файл.pfx -clcerts -nokeys -out сертификат.crt

6. Теперь у вас есть отдельный ключ KEY и сертификат CRT, готовые к использованию в вашем веб-сервере или другом приложении.

Это один из способов конвертирования PFX в форматы CRT и KEY в Windows. Убедитесь, что вы следуете инструкциям внимательно и остерегайтесь ошибок при выполнении этих шагов. Кроме того, учтите, что результаты могут отличаться в зависимости от вашей системы и используемой версии OpenSSL.

Знакомство с форматом PFX

Файлы формата PFX широко применяются в операционных системах Windows и многих других программных продуктах, поддерживающих криптографические операции. Они предоставляют удобный способ хранения и передачи сертификатов и ключей в безопасном формате.

Основным преимуществом формата PFX является возможность объединения закрытого ключа и связанного сертификата в одном файле. Это сильно упрощает процесс установки и настройки сертификатов на серверах или клиентских устройствах. Файлы PFX также защищены паролем, что обеспечивает дополнительный уровень безопасности.

  • Обмен сертификатами и ключами в формате PFX является стандартной практикой в сфере информационной безопасности.
  • Для создания PFX-файла необходимо обратиться к удостоверяющему центру (ЦУЦ) или использовать специальные программы и утилиты, предоставляемые разработчиками.
  • При работе с PFX-файлами важно обеспечить защиту пароля и хранить файлы в надежном, недоступном для посторонних лиц месте.

Зачем нужно конвертировать PFX в CRT и KEY?

Когда речь идет о конвертации PFX в CRT и KEY, это может вызвать некоторую путаницу. Однако, существуют ситуации, когда вам может понадобиться конвертировать формат PFX (Personal Information Exchange) в CRT (Certificate) и KEY (Private Key). Давайте разберемся, почему это может быть необходимо.

Во-первых, формат PFX является одним из самых распространенных форматов для хранения и передачи сертификатов. Он объединяет сертификат и личный ключ в одном файле, что делает его удобным для установки и использования на веб-серверах или других системах, поддерживающих данный формат. Однако, некоторые приложения могут требовать использование отдельных файлов CRT и KEY. В таком случае, конвертация PFX в CRT и KEY становится необходимой.

Во-вторых, конвертация формата PFX в CRT и KEY может быть также полезна для управления и обновления сертификатов. Некоторые сервисы или устройства могут предоставлять возможность загрузки только отдельных файлов CRT и KEY для установки сертификата. Путем конвертации PFX в CRT и KEY, вы получаете возможность гибкого управления своими сертификатами и их установкой на различные системы или устройства.

Читайте также:  Менеджер windows 64 bit

Как конвертировать PFX в CRT и KEY с помощью командной строки

Существуют различные способы конвертирования PFX в CRT и KEY, но одним из самых удобных и быстрых является использование командной строки. Для этого необходимо выполнить несколько простых шагов.

Шаг 1:

Откройте командную строку на вашем компьютере. Для этого нажмите кнопку «Пуск», введите «cmd» в поле поиска и выберите приложение «Командная строка».

Шаг 2:

Перейдите в папку, в которой находится файл PFX, который вы хотите сконвертировать. Для этого введите команду «cd ПУТЬ_К_ПАПКЕ» и нажмите Enter. Например, если ваш файл PFX находится в папке «C:\certificates», введите «cd C:\certificates».

Шаг 3:

Выполните команду конвертации, указав имя файла PFX, имя файла CRT и имя файла KEY. Для этого введите следующую команду и нажмите Enter:

openssl pkcs12 -in ПУТЬ_К_ФАЙЛУ.PFX -clcerts -nokeys -out ПУТЬ_К_ФАЙЛУ.CRT

где «ПУТЬ_К_ФАЙЛУ.PFX» — это путь к файлу PFX, «ПУТЬ_К_ФАЙЛУ.CRT» — это путь, по которому будет сохранен новый файл CRT.

Затем выполните следующую команду, чтобы извлечь закрытый ключ:

openssl pkcs12 -in ПУТЬ_К_ФАЙЛУ.PFX -nocerts -nodes -out ПУТЬ_К_ФАЙЛУ.KEY

где «ПУТЬ_К_ФАЙЛУ.KEY» — это путь, по которому будет сохранен новый файл KEY.

После выполнения этих команд в указанных папках будут созданы файлы CRT и KEY, содержащие конвертированные данные из PFX.

Теперь вы можете использовать файлы CRT и KEY для настройки сертификата на вашем сервере или другом устройстве, требующем использования отдельных файлов для закрытого ключа и открытого сертификата.

Использование утилиты OpenSSL для конвертирования PFX в CRT и KEY

При работе с сертификатами SSL/TLS часто возникает необходимость сконвертировать формат файла, чтобы сделать его совместимым с различными программами и устройствами. В этой статье мы рассмотрим, как с помощью утилиты OpenSSL можно конвертировать файл формата PFX в форматы CRT и KEY.

OpenSSL — это мощный инструмент, который позволяет работать с шифрованием и сертификатами SSL/TLS. Он поддерживает множество алгоритмов шифрования и форматов файлов, включая PFX, CRT и KEY.

Для начала процесса конвертирования PFX в CRT и KEY, мы должны установить утилиту OpenSSL на нашем компьютере. Затем мы переходим к командной строке и используем следующую команду:

openssl pkcs12 -in example.pfx -clcerts -nokeys -out certificate.crt

В этой команде «example.pfx» — это путь к нашему исходному файлу PFX, «certificate.crt» — это конечный файл формата CRT, который мы хотим получить. OpenSSL извлекает общий сертификат из PFX и сохраняет его в файле CRT.

Читайте также:  Ошибка 769 указанное назначение недостижимо windows xp

Для получения файла формата KEY, мы используем следующую команду:

openssl pkcs12 -in example.pfx -nocerts -out private.key

Здесь «private.key» — это конечный файл формата KEY, который содержит приватный ключ. OpenSSL извлекает приватный ключ из PFX и сохраняет его в файле KEY.

Теперь у нас есть файлы CRT и KEY, полученные из исходного PFX. Мы можем использовать их для установки сертификата на веб-сервере или других устройствах, требующих этих форматов.

Импорт конвертированных CRT и KEY в Windows

Одним из способов импортировать конвертированные файлы .crt и .key в Windows является использование утилиты OpenSSL. OpenSSL — это набор инструментов с открытым исходным кодом, которые позволяют работать с шифрованием и сертификатами. Сначала вам нужно установить OpenSSL на свой компьютер. Затем вы можете использовать команду OpenSSL для конвертации файла .pfx в .crt и .key.

Чтобы импортировать конвертированные файлы .crt и .key в Windows, вы можете воспользоваться MMC (Microsoft Management Console) — инструментом управления в Windows. Сначала откройте MMC, выбрав «Пуск», затем «Выполнить» и введите «mmc». Затем выберите «Файл» в верхнем левом углу и нажмите «Добавить/удалить элементы управления». В окне «Доступные элементы управления» найдите «Сертификаты» и добавьте его в MMC.

Заключение

Мы подробно рассмотрели процесс конвертации PFX файла в CRT и KEY файлы с помощью утилиты OpenSSL. Мы узнали, что для создания CRT файла необходимо извлечь сертификат из PFX файла, а для создания KEY файла — приватный ключ. Также мы рассмотрели способы установки полученных CRT и KEY файлов в IIS с помощью интерфейса управления или командной строки.

Кроме того, мы обсудили проблемы, с которыми можно столкнуться при работе с конвертированными CRT и KEY файлами. Мы выяснили, что некорректные или неправильно сконвертированные файлы могут привести к проблемам с установкой сертификатов на сервере. Поэтому рекомендуется внимательно следить за правильностью процесса конвертации и проверять файлы перед их установкой.

Наконец, мы рассмотрели важность безопасности при работе с конвертированными CRT и KEY файлами. Мы подчеркнули, что сертификаты и ключи безопасности являются критической частью защиты веб-сайтов и должны быть хранены в надежном и защищенном месте. Рекомендуется использовать пароль для защиты приватного ключа и обеспечить ограниченный доступ к файлам сертификатов.

В целом, понимание процесса работы с конвертированными CRT и KEY файлами в IIS является важным для администраторов серверов и разработчиков веб-сайтов. Надеюсь, что данная статья была полезной и поможет вам успешно установить и использовать сертификаты безопасности на вашем веб-сервере.

Оцените статью